POSITION SUMMARY

The year-round Intern program is designed for people who are deeply committed to Jesus Christ and desire to intern at camps to help create and provide an environment where staff, volunteers, and guests of Miracle Ranch can experience Christ. We believe this will be a life-changing experience where each intern will grow spiritually, personally, relationally, and professionally and will come away more energized and prepared for a lifetime of service. Interns will be part of the camp community and expected to be regularly involved in community activities. 

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

(General overview and may not include all details of responsibilities) 

DUTIES

  1. Program – hosting guest groups, facilitating activities, summers staff recruiting, program planning, sound and video operation.
  2. Maintenance – general repairs, landscaping, vehicle operation and maintenance.
  3. Housekeeping – cabin turnover, laundry, general cleaning.
  4. Kitchen – food prep, inventory, meal service.
  5. Horsemanship- Horse weekends, trail rides, feeding and cleaning of animals and other horse events.
  6. Marketing- Events marketing, development of promo material, phone calls, etc.
  7. Work collaboratively with all Camps staff and customers.
  8. Perform other related duties as assigned.

NON-DISCRIMINATION STATEMENT
 

CRISTA is a Christian, religious organization that lives out its faith-based mission through five ministries: CRISTA Camps, CRISTA Media, CRISTA Senior Living, King’s Schools, and World Concern.  As permitted by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964, CRISTA reserves the right to prefer employees of a particular religion and to require its employees to hold certain religious beliefs, engage in certain religious observances, and engage in or refrain from engaging in certain behavior, based on CRISTA’s religious beliefs. CRISTA’s employees must agree with and support without reservation CRISTA’s Statement of Faith and must conduct themselves in accordance with the religious beliefs and practices that flow from that Statement of Faith and CRISTA’s Christian Community Policy.

Among those employees and employment applicants who agree with and support without reservation and abide by the Statement of Faith and CRISTA’s Christian Community Policy, CRISTA does not unlawfully discriminate on the basis of race, color, national origin, age, sex, disability, genetic information, or any other protected characteristic.
